This post compares Norwalk, California to American Canyon, California across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.

Dimension Norwalk (city) American Canyon (city)
Population 106,404 20,341
Income (median) $38,524 $54,617
Home Value (median) $375,400 $418,600
White 48% 38%
Black 4% 8%
Asian 13% 35%
With Kids 43% 50%
Age (median) 34 36
Rentals 37% 21%
